Strategic Use of Merchant Cash Advance in Michigan

For food service operators in Michigan, quick funding can be crucial. A Merchant Cash Advance provides capital with a funding speed of 1 to 3 business days. This rapid access enables businesses to seize opportunities or address urgent needs without protracted waiting periods. For example, purchasing perishable inventory at a discount, covering an unexpected equipment repair, or managing a temporary dip in sales can all benefit from immediate capital.

The repayment structure, which moves with daily card volume, offers flexibility. If a day or week is slower than anticipated, the repayment adjusts accordingly. This differs from fixed payment structures, providing a degree of adaptability that can be valuable for businesses with fluctuating revenue streams. This cost structure, while a factor rate, aligns repayment with actual sales performance.

Common questions

What is a Merchant Cash Advance?

A Merchant Cash Advance provides funding for food businesses with repayment tied to their daily credit card sales volume. It is not a loan, but rather a purchase of future receivables.

How does repayment work for a Merchant Cash Advance?

Repayment for a Merchant Cash Advance moves with your daily card volume. Instead of a fixed date, a percentage of your daily credit card sales is remitted until the advance is repaid.
